Graziano and Franklin Lift Canton to Top 20 Finish in State Open

Canton High School senior Matt Graziano took home his second State Open title in discus Monday, after earning his second Class S championship a week before, according to the Collinsville Press.  

The win is unprecedented. Graziano is the first Canton High School athlete to win two straight State Open titles and one of only five to win just one, the Press said.  

The title caps a winning season for Graziano during which he has repeatedly thrown the discus beyond the competition area’s boundaries, the Press reported.    

Several other Canton athletes also turned in stellar performances at Monday’s State Open at Willow Brook Park in New Britain.  

Julian Franklin, a senior, equaled Graziano’s 14 points, coming in fifth in the triple jump and setting a school record of 44 feet. Finishing 12th in the long jump, Franklin missed making the finals by just 2 inches.  

Both Graziano and Franklin qualified to go on to the New England championship meet Saturday in New Britain.  

Canton’s Colin Martin, Keith Goeben, Jimmy Spatcher, Keith Wilson finished 15th in the men’s 4x400. Its 4x800 relay team, made up of Spatcher, James Yost, Athen Chekas and Matt DeMarco, finished 17th.  

Keith Wilson also finished 14th in the 400 meters while James Yost finished 19th in the 3,200 meters.  

The team overall finished 16th at the Open. Complete results from the meet are here.
